Telltale Signs Your AC Unit Needs to Be Replaced
It can be tempting to schedule yet another repair, but sometimes replacement is the more financially sound and logical long-term solution. Recognizing the warning signs can save you from the stress of a complete system failure during the hottest days of the year.
Your AC is Over 10-15 Years OldEven with diligent maintenance, the average central air conditioner has a lifespan of about 15 years. As a unit ages, its efficiency declines dramatically, and critical components begin to wear out, making it far more susceptible to failure.
Frequent and Costly RepairsIf you find yourself on a first-name basis with your repair technician, it's a clear signal. When repair costs start to approach a significant fraction of the price of a new unit, you are investing in failing technology. A replacement offers a fresh start with a reliable system backed by a manufacturer's warranty.
Steadily Rising Energy BillsAn unexplained spike in your summer utility bills is often one of the first indicators of a failing air conditioner. As internal parts degrade, the system must work harder and run longer to achieve the same level of cooling, consuming significantly more electricity in the process.
Inconsistent Cooling and Hot SpotsDoes your AC struggle to maintain the temperature set on the thermostat? Are some rooms comfortable while others remain stuffy and warm? This inability to cool your home evenly suggests your unit is losing capacity and can no longer meet your home's cooling demands.
Strange Noises or OdorsAir conditioners should operate with a consistent, low hum. Loud grinding, squealing, or clanking sounds can indicate serious mechanical problems, such as a failing motor or compressor. Likewise, musty or burning smells are red flags that warrant immediate professional attention and often signal the end of the unit's life.
Our Comprehensive AC Replacement Process
We believe in a meticulous, transparent process that prioritizes your home's specific needs and ensures your new system performs flawlessly from day one.
1. In-Depth Home Assessment and Load CalculationA successful replacement begins with understanding your home's unique cooling requirements. We don't just swap out the old unit for a new one of the same size. Our technicians perform a professional load calculation (Manual J) that considers factors like your home's square footage, insulation levels, window placement, and layout. This scientific approach guarantees your new AC is perfectly sized—not too big and not too small—for maximum efficiency and comfort.
2. Expert Guidance and System SelectionNavigating the world of modern air conditioners can be overwhelming. We act as your trusted advisors, explaining the differences between various types of systems, including central air conditioners and high-efficiency heat pumps. We’ll help you understand SEER2 (Seasonal Energy Efficiency Ratio 2) ratings, demystify advanced features like variable-speed compressors, and recommend the best equipment to match your performance goals and budget.
3. Professional Removal and DisposalOur team handles the entire process of safely disconnecting and removing your old, bulky air conditioning system. We take care to protect your property during the removal and ensure that the old equipment and any refrigerants are disposed of in an environmentally responsible manner, following all local and federal regulations.
4. Precision InstallationThe quality of the installation is just as important as the quality of the unit itself. Our certified technicians install your new indoor and outdoor components with exacting precision. This includes making secure electrical connections, ensuring proper refrigerant levels, and inspecting your existing ductwork for any leaks or issues that could compromise the new system's performance.
5. System Commissioning and TestingOnce installed, we don't just turn the system on and leave. We conduct a thorough commissioning process, testing every function to verify that it is operating according to the manufacturer’s specifications. We calibrate the thermostat, measure airflow, and ensure the system cycles correctly, delivering optimal cooling and efficiency.
The Tangible Benefits of a Modern AC System
Upgrading your air conditioner is an investment that pays you back in numerous ways, enhancing your daily life and improving your home's long-term health.
Significant Reduction in Energy CostsToday's air conditioners are far more efficient than models from a decade ago. Upgrading from an older, low-SEER unit to a new high-efficiency model can slash your summer cooling costs, providing substantial savings on your monthly utility bills.
Superior Home ComfortNew systems with advanced technology like variable-speed blowers provide more consistent temperatures throughout your home, eliminating hot and cold spots. They are also superior at managing humidity, creating a less sticky and more comfortable indoor environment.
Improved Indoor Air QualityA new AC system can be integrated with advanced filtration and air purification products. This helps capture airborne contaminants like dust, pollen, pet dander, and mold spores, allowing your family to breathe cleaner, healthier air.
Quiet and Peaceful OperationModern air conditioners are engineered for quiet performance. Insulated compressor compartments and advanced fan blade designs significantly reduce operating noise compared to older, clunky units, allowing you to enjoy a more peaceful home.
